Profitec Pro 300: Panel Removal

Below you will find step-by-step instructions as well as a video on how to remove the panels from a Profitec Pro 300 Espresso Machine.

 


Tools needed:

  • 2.5mm allen key
  • 3mm allen key

Please make sure that your boilers are drained and your machine is cool to the touch before you begin.

1) Remove the top panel by using the 2.5mm allen key.

2) Inside the front panel, you will need to remove these 2 screws.

3) Lay the machine on its back and use the 3mm allen key to remove the 4 screws that hold the side panels to the bottom of the machine.

4. On each side of the machine, there is a screw that fits into a slot which is shaped like a pear. To get the side panels free, you will need to push the side panels down to let the screw match up with the wider part of the slot, allowing it to pass through and then pull the panels out.

5) You will need to clear the inner L-shaped tabs from the front panel to allow them to come off. After they are free you can simply lift the side panels out and off of the machine (These metal tabs have been omitted in the newer models).

6) If you need to gain access to the internals, you can remove the reservoir holder by using the 3mm allen key to unscrew these two on the bottom of the machine.

7) If you need to completely remove the reservoir holder, you will need to disconnect the tubes on the adaptor piece, and unplug the two wires.

6) Follow these directions in reverse to reassemble.
